Our Lady of Lourdes’ Youth Ministry process offers opportunities for parish members in grades 7-12 to be involved, active, concerned, and to grow in their faith.

The eight components of a comprehensive ministry process, outlined in the National Conference of Catholic Bishops’ “Renewing the Vision: A Framework for Catholic Youth Ministry,” are implemented:

Advocacy – speaking on behalf of those in need

Catechesis – using sacred Scripture and Tradition to form disciples

Community Life – an environment of concern, support, and appreciation of diversity

Justice and Service – working for justice, serving those in need, pursuing peace and respecting the life, dignity, and rights of all people

Leadership – calling forth, affirming, and empowering the gifts, talents, and abilities of youth

Prayer and Worship – celebrating and deepening our relationship with God through communal and liturgical prayer

Evangelization – inviting and empowering people to live as disciples

Pastoral Care – compassionate presence and outreach to those in need

Our Lady of Lourdes’ Youth Ministry process is a call to action, a truly lived faith.
